ДАТЧИК СЛУЧАЙНЫХ ЧИСЕЛ Советский патент 1974 года по МПК G06F7/58 

Описание патента на изобретение SU430371A1

1

Изобретение относится к области вычислительной техники и может использоваться для формирования люслелчовательностей равновероятных многоразрядных случайных чисел.

Р звестны датчики случайных чисел, содержащие рекуррентный регистр сдвига и генератор импульсов, обеспечивающие равновероятную выборку любой кодовой комбинации из последовательности максимальной длины.

Одпако в некоторых случаях возникает необходимость равновероятной выборки iV-pasрядных чнсел, составляющих определенное подмножество в полном наборе генерируемых устройством комбинаций.

Целью изобретения является обеспечение возможности равновероятной выборки Л-разрядиых чисел, составляющих онределенное подмножество в полном наборе кодовых комбинаций и расширение тем самым класса рещаемых задач.

Это достигается тем, что в предлагаемом датчике выходы рекуррентного регистра сдвига соединены с входами анализатора кодовых комбинаций и с информациоиными входами вентилей, первые и вторые управляющие входы которых соединены соответственно с выходами анализатора кодовых комбинаций и нервой схемы совнадения, выход анализатора кодовых комбинаций подключен к первому входу второй схемы совпадепия, вторые входы схем

совпадеиия соединены с выходом схемы унравления, выход второй схемы совпадения подсоединен к запрещающему входу триггера, выходом подключенного к первому входу

первой схемы совпадеиия, выход генератора импульсов соедииеп с первым входом схемы запрета, второй вход которой соединен с выходом первой схемы совпаде1 ия, а выход - с управляющим входом рекуррентного регистра

сдвига.

На чертеже ириведепа функциональная схема предлагаемого датчика.

Датчик содержит генератор импульсов /, вырабатывающий «периодическую импульсную последовательность, которая поступает иа первый вход схемы 2 запрета и с выхода схемы запрета иа управляющий вход рекуррентного регистра сдвига 3. В регистре вырабатывается линейная последовательность максимальной длины. Параллельные выходы регистра 3 подключены к информационным входам вентилей 4 и одновременно к входам анализатора 5 кодовых комбииаций. На унравляющие входы вентилей поступают соответственно сигналы с выхода анализатора 5 и схемы совпадения 6. Вентили открываются при наличии разрещающих сигналов на обоих управляющих входах. Вход схемы совнадения 6 подключен к выходу триггера 7, запоминающего

момент поступления на датчик сигнала заироса. На второй вход схемы совпадения 6 поступают сигналы опроса с частотой FQ с выхода схемы 8 управления. Выход схемы совпадения 6 подключен к запрещающему входу схемы 2 запрета. На запрещающий вход триггера 7 поступают сигналы с выхода схемы совпадения 9, входы которой подключены к выходам анализатора 5 и схемы 8 управления.

В исходном состоянии триггер 7 погащеп, сигналы генератора / производят «периодические сдвиги в рекуррентном регистре 3, выходные вентили 4 закрыты. Нри поступлении на вхо/т, датчика сигнала запроса перебрасывается триггер 7, при этом с его выхода на схему совпадения 6 подается разрешающий сигнал. Нри наличии разрешающего сигнала нмпульсы опроса -Fo со схемы 8 управления через схему совпадения 6 поступают на запрещающий вход схемы 2 запрета и управляющий вход вентилей 4. В регистре фиксируется сомбинация, сформировавшаяся к моменту поступления импульса опроса. Если эта комбинация входит в анализируемое подмножество, анализатор 5 выдает сигнал на другой управляющий вход вентилей. Нри этом Л-разрядная комбинация считывается с датчика случайных чисел. Одновременно схема совпадения 9 выдает команду гашения триггера.

Если зафиксированная в регистре комбинация не входит в анализируемое подмножество, сдвнги в регистре возобновляются до прихода очередиого импульса опроса. Опросы состояния регистра повторяются до тех пор, пока импульс опроса не совпадет по времени с паличием в регистре разрешенной комбинации. Нри этом схема возвращается в исходное состояние до прихода следующего сигнала запроса.

С веряотпостью Р можно утверждать, что количество /С опросов, пеобходимых для формирования очередного случайного числа, не превысит числа

in 1-Р ,v-m,

где п - полное число комбинаций в ,V-разрядпом регистре; т - число комбинаций в подмно0жестве.

Нредмет изобретения

. Датчик случайных чисел, содержащий генератор импульсов, рекуррептпый регистр сдвига, отличающийся тем, что, с целью расщирения класса решаемых задач, оп содержит схему запрета, вентили, анализатор кодовых комбинаций, цервую и вторую схемы совпадения, схему управления и триггер, причем выходы рек ррентного регистра сдвига соединены с входами анализатора кодовых комбинаций и с информационными входами вентилей, нервые и вторые управляющие входы которых соединены соответственно с выходами апалпзатора кодовых комбинаций и первой схемы совпадения, выход анализатора кодовых комбинаций нодключен к первому входу второй схемы совпадения, вторые входы схем совпадения соединены с выходом схемы управления, выход второй схемы совнадеиия подсоединен к запрещающему входу триггера, выходом подключепного к первому входу первой схемы совпадения, выход генератора импульсов соединен с первым входом схемы запрета, второй вход которой соединен с выходом первой схемы совпадения, а выход - с управляюпщм входом рекуррентного регистра сдвига.

Запрос

Похожие патенты SU430371A1

название год авторы номер документа
Датчик случайных чисел 1985
  • Куницына Людмила Тихоновна
  • Тюрин Сергей Владимирович
SU1327100A2
Датчик случайных чисел 1984
  • Куницына Людмила Тихоновна
  • Сергеев Вячеслав Владимирович
  • Тюрин Сергей Владимирович
SU1229760A1
Генератор случайных чисел 1988
  • Бараненко Петр Михайлович
  • Борисенко Федор Стефанович
  • Гордеев Александр Павлович
SU1689948A1
УСТРОЙСТВО Д.ЛЯ ПРОВЕРКИ ПРЕОБРАЗОВАТЕЛЕЙ«УГОЛ-КОД» 1972
SU419939A1
УСТРОЙСТВО ДЛЯ ГЕНЕРИРОВАНИЯ СЛУЧАЙНЫХ ЧИСЕЛ С ЗАДАН'НЫМИ ЗАКОНАМИ РАСПРЕДЕЛЕНИЯ 1972
SU430368A1
Устройство для имитации искажений телеграфных сигналов 1975
  • Булдыгин Владимир Сергеевич
  • Гладилин Николай Дмитриевич
  • Кувшиновский Валерий Сергеевич
  • Марченко Владимир Афанасьевич
SU567216A1
Генератор случайных чисел 1981
  • Егоров Николай Николаевич
  • Моисеев Василий Куприянович
SU991422A1
Адаптивный статистический анализатор 1980
  • Ветшев Жорж Николаевич
SU955090A1
УСТРОЙСТВО УПРАВЛЕНИЯ ПЕРЕДАЧЕЙ ДАННЫХ ПО РАДИОКАНАЛУ 2004
  • Пофланков А.В.
  • Шарко А.Г.
  • Шарко Г.В.
RU2259017C1
ДАТЧИК СЛУЧАЙНЫХ ЧИСЕЛ 1965
SU168545A1

Иллюстрации к изобретению SU 430 371 A1

Реферат патента 1974 года ДАТЧИК СЛУЧАЙНЫХ ЧИСЕЛ

Формула изобретения SU 430 371 A1

SU 430 371 A1

Даты

1974-05-30Публикация

1973-03-28Подача